25 lines
406 B
Markdown
25 lines
406 B
Markdown
|
|
# oink 🐷
|
|
|
|
A configuration file preprocessor written in Rust.
|
|
|
|
## Usage
|
|
|
|
```sh
|
|
|
|
# process config files
|
|
oink build
|
|
# apply processed configs
|
|
oink apply
|
|
|
|
# build and apply
|
|
oink full
|
|
|
|
```
|
|
|
|
## Libraries
|
|
|
|
- [pico-args](https://crates.io/crates/pico-args) — argument parsing
|
|
- [tera](https://crates.io/crates/tera) — template replacement
|
|
- [toml](https://crates.io/crates/toml) — configuration parsing
|
|
|